12.01.21 | Yeah, from an interview i read:
Upon the record’s completion, the plan was just to make 25 copies and share them among Balfe’s inner circle, most of whom are directly addressed somewhere in the nine songs. But “one thing led to another” and after a couple of highly regarded early singles and an appearance on Later…with Jools Holland, the record is now primed for release on 26 March on September Recordings [where he now shares management with the likes of Adele and Glass Animals]. It is fair to say that early responses have been strong, especially in regard to the song ‘I Have a Love’, which addresses Curran directly. |

29. Mohabbat by Arooj Aftab: ah yes, Pakistani folky music. I'm lucky that Urdu is really similar to Hindi so I can kinda understand this a little bit. From what I can gather it's a song about how they're "not the one" for this other person and that they're going on separate paths. Really beautiful voice, and I'm kinda digging the culture deep cuts here since this is a ghazal. This has more of the indie folk instruments going for it instead which I also really like. I don't mind the length of the song - long folk tunes are kinda my vibe right now anyway. I'll check out the album and add this song to my "Haunting Folk" playlist. =) [4.7]
